Since 1995 the year 1995, every Saab is required to have an immobilizer for vehicles. This makes it almost impossible to steal a vehicle without a specific key. The key needs a special transponder that is embedded in it for it to start the engine and open your doors. The key also needs a transmitter/transponder chip that needs to be matched with the car's computer module in order to work. This can only be done by a dealer, with the special tool called a Tech-2 or a similar type of software.

Replacement

Saab owners who purchased their Saab from 1994 and up are advised to have two working keys for their car. Replacing the sole key is expensive and complicated. The dealer must replace the CIM (Column Integration Module) or TWICE (Theft Warning Integrated Central Electronics), depending on the model, and also the key itself. In addition it must be programmed to work with the new module. Keys that are claimed-new from sellers on the aftermarket are generally not properly initialized and not program correctly when you need them.
